  8. Caley D - I don't see anyone suggesting that we have a right to win this. I think 4 - 5 - 1 could be a useful formation to employ. It serves Chelsea well in that they play defensive and soak up oressure but just as quickly launch a counter attack with the 2 wide midfielders acting as extra forwards. This is the kind of tactic we seem to use very well - soak up pressure and hit on the break. I think the one key thing we have to do is pass the football and get away from the long ball.

  13. I would go with that actually Gaz. I think that is an excellent set up. Use Wilson and Rankin as wide attacking midfielders like we used Bingham and Wilson when Robbo used his front 3 that had Ritchie as the main striker. Of course Bayne would take over this role here. By having Duncan as a sitting midfielder that means we can afford to have Rankin and Wilson push further forward and when they do Black and McBain,when on the defensive, can drop a bit to the right and left respectively to fill out the midfield a bit more when defending.

  16. Here is the team that played so well against Celtic. Inverness CT: Fraser, Tokely, Dods, Munro, Hastings, Wilson, McBain, Duncan (Black 74), Rankin, Bayne, Wyness (McAllister 2), McAllister (Paatelainen 84). Subs Not Used: Ridgers, McCaffrey, Morgan, Soane. Here is the team that played so poorly against Hearts. Inverness CT: Fraser, Tokely, Dods, Munro, Hastings, Wilson (McSwegan 85), McBain, Duncan, Rankin (Morgan 63), Bayne, McAllister. Subs Not Used: Ridgers, McCaffrey, Black, Paatelainen, Soane. Here is the team that played so (apparently) poorly against Motherwell. Inverness CT: Fraser, Tokely, Dods, Munro, Hastings, Wilson, Duncan (Black 70), McBain, Rankin (Paatelainen 72), McAllister (McSwegan 75), Bayne. So that's pretty much man for man the exact same team that played so well against Celtic yet has been so poor in the last couple of games.
